From: Katayama Hirofumi MZ Date: Sun, 19 Aug 2018 04:38:06 +0000 (+0900) Subject: [FONT][WIN32SS] Refactor the loop (4 of 5) X-Git-Tag: 0.4.11-dev~42 X-Git-Url: https://git.reactos.org/?p=reactos.git;a=commitdiff_plain;h=b9b4c903037457ad12a85dbec15ca3e2a54b7c9a;hp=7b04962aed7f6d017d4bebb8dc5175f87ef9ed1e [FONT][WIN32SS] Refactor the loop (4 of 5) --- diff --git a/win32ss/gdi/ntgdi/freetype.c b/win32ss/gdi/ntgdi/freetype.c index 013c0bb6a4b..97d4b2d14c3 100644 --- a/win32ss/gdi/ntgdi/freetype.c +++ b/win32ss/gdi/ntgdi/freetype.c @@ -2672,8 +2672,9 @@ ftGdiGlyphCacheGet( ASSERT_FREETYPE_LOCK_HELD(); - CurrentEntry = g_FontCacheListHead.Flink; - while (CurrentEntry != &g_FontCacheListHead) + for (CurrentEntry = g_FontCacheListHead.Flink; + CurrentEntry != &g_FontCacheListHead; + CurrentEntry = CurrentEntry->Flink) { FontEntry = CONTAINING_RECORD(CurrentEntry, FONT_CACHE_ENTRY, ListEntry); if ((FontEntry->Face == Face) && @@ -2682,7 +2683,6 @@ ftGdiGlyphCacheGet( (FontEntry->RenderMode == RenderMode) && (SameScaleMatrix(&FontEntry->mxWorldToDevice, pmx))) break; - CurrentEntry = CurrentEntry->Flink; } if (CurrentEntry == &g_FontCacheListHead)